Highlights

On average, there are 220 sunny days per year in Casper. Berthoud averages 240 sunny days per year. The US average is 205 sunny days.

Casper, Wyoming gets 13 inches of rain, on average, per year. Berthoud, Colorado gets 15.5 inches of rain, on average, per year. The US average is 38.1 inches of rain per year.

Casper averages 70.3 inches of snow per year. Berthoud averages 38.5 inches of snow per year. The US average is 27.8 inches of snow per year.

July is the hottest month for Berthoud with an average high temperature of 88.5°, which ranks it as about average compared to other places in Colorado. In Berthoud, there are 3 comfortable months with high temperatures in the range of 70-85°. The most pleasant months of the year for Berthoud are September, June and May.

July is the hottest month for Casper with an average high temperature of 88.2°, which ranks it as warmer than most places in Wyoming. In Casper, there are 2 comfortable months with high temperatures in the range of 70-85°. The most pleasant months of the year for Casper are June, September and August.


December has the coldest nighttime temperatures for Berthoud with an average of 13.1°. This is colder than most places in Colorado.

January has the coldest nighttime temperatures for Casper with an average of 15.4°. This is one of the warmest places in Wyoming.



In Berthoud, there are 33.2 days annually when the high temperature is over 90°, which is hotter than most places in Colorado.

In Casper, there are 29.7 days annually when the high temperature is over 90°, which is hotter than most places in Wyoming.



In Berthoud, there are 174.5 days annually when the nighttime low temperature falls below freezing, which is about average compared to other places in Colorado.

In Casper, there are 168.3 days annually when the nighttime low temperature falls below freezing, which is one of the warmest places in Wyoming.



In Berthoud, there are 10.2 days annually when the nighttime low temperature falls below zero°, which is colder than most places in Colorado.

In Casper, there are 12.5 days annually when the nighttime low temperature falls below zero°, which is warmer than most places in Wyoming.



May is the wettest month in Berthoud with 2.5 inches of rain, and the driest month is January with 0.5 inches. The wettest season is Summer with 38% of yearly precipitation and 10% occurs in Spring, which is the driest season. The annual rainfall of 15.5 inches in Berthoud means that it is drier than most places in Colorado.


May is the wettest month in Casper with 2.2 inches of rain, and the driest month is January with 0.5 inches. The wettest season is Summer with 35% of yearly precipitation and 14% occurs in Spring, which is the driest season. The annual rainfall of 13.0 inches in Casper means that it is about average compared to other places in Wyoming.


May is the rainiest month in Berthoud with 10.4 days of rain, and January is the driest month with only 4.2 rainy days. There are 80.8 rainy days annually in Berthoud, which is about average compared to other places in Colorado. The rainiest season is Autumn when it rains 31% of the time and the driest is Spring with only a 16% chance of a rainy day.

May is the rainiest month in Casper with 10.0 days of rain, and January is the driest month with only 5.0 rainy days. There are 79.2 rainy days annually in Casper, which is rainier than most places in Wyoming. The rainiest season is Summer when it rains 32% of the time and the driest is Spring with only a 20% chance of a rainy day.



An annual snowfall of 38.5 inches in Berthoud means that it is less snowy than most places in Colorado.

An annual snowfall of 70.3 inches in Casper means that it is snowier than most places in Wyoming.



March is the snowiest month in Berthoud with 8.2 inches of snow, and 7 months of the year have significant snowfall.

March is the snowiest month in Casper with 11.5 inches of snow, and 9 months of the year have significant snowfall.


DID YOU KNOW?

Many people confuse Weather and Climate, but they are different. Weather refers to the conditions of the atmosphere over a short period of time, while Climate refers to the conditions of the atmosphere over a long period of time.

Weather, more specifically, refers to how the atmosphere behaves and its effects on life and human activities. Most people think of Weather in terms of what can be observed: temperature, humidity, precipitation, and cloudy/sunny conditions. Weather conditions constantly change on a minute-to-minute basis.

Climate is a record of the average weather conditions for a given place over a long period of time, often referred to as Climate Normals. A 30-year period of record is a common requirement to be considered a Climate Normal.
